Essentials & Excitement Backpacking 101 in the USA

Embarking on a backpacking journey across the stunning landscapes of the United States is an experience like none better. But before you hit the trails, there are some fundamental things to pack and plan for. Beginning with, your backpack should be well-fitted and comfortable. Choose a pack size matching your trip length and gear needs.

  • Don't forget a lightweight tent, sleeping bag rated for the expected temperatures, and a comfortable sleeping pad.
  • Keeping hydrated is critical, so bring a water filter or purification tablets and a ample water supply.
  • Getting around, consider bringing a paper map and compass, as cell service can be unreliable in remote areas.

With these basics in hand, you're ready to venture the diverse trails of the USA.
